Benutzer-Werkzeuge

Webseiten-Werkzeuge


cocoaheads:binary_search

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Beide Seiten der vorigen RevisionVorhergehende Überarbeitung
Nächste Überarbeitung
Vorhergehende Überarbeitung
cocoaheads:binary_search [2011/01/26 18:38] mrococoaheads:binary_search [2011/01/27 10:54] (aktuell) – [Sqlite Fulltext Index] mro
Zeile 27: Zeile 27:
  * :-( ''where <Spalte> like 'term%''' geht nicht über den Index  * :-( ''where <Spalte> like 'term%''' geht nicht über den Index
  * :-( ''where <Spalte> BEGINSWITH 'term''' geht **auch** nicht über den Index  * :-( ''where <Spalte> BEGINSWITH 'term''' geht **auch** nicht über den Index
- * erst der [[http://blog.mro.name/2009/10/cocoatouch-coredata-and-binary-string-search/|Trick mit > und <]] benutzt den Index dann ist's flott.+ * erst der [[http://blog.mro.name/2009/10/cocoatouch-coredata-and-binary-string-search/|Trick mit ''BETWEEN'']] benutzt den Index 
 +dann ist's flott.
  
 == Sqlite Fulltext Index == Sqlite Fulltext Index
  
 http://blog.mro.name/2010/03/iphone-sqlite-fulltext-index/  http://blog.mro.name/2010/03/iphone-sqlite-fulltext-index/ 
 +
  * SQLite 'Amalgam' (alles in einer Datei) Quellen runterladen und in's Projekt damit,  * SQLite 'Amalgam' (alles in einer Datei) Quellen runterladen und in's Projekt damit,
- * [[http://www.v2ex.com/2008/11/22/full-text-search/|FTS3]] einschalten,+ * [[http://www.sqlite.org/fts3.html#section_2|FTS3]] einschalten,
  * [[http://www.sqlite.org/fts3.html#section_1_1|Index Tabelle anlegen]] (auf dem Gerät),  * [[http://www.sqlite.org/fts3.html#section_1_1|Index Tabelle anlegen]] (auf dem Gerät),
  * normal benutzen, aber den [[http://www.sqlite.org/fts3.html#section_3|MATCH Operator]] benutzen  * normal benutzen, aber den [[http://www.sqlite.org/fts3.html#section_3|MATCH Operator]] benutzen
Zeile 42: Zeile 44:
 für Eure Aufmerksamkeit. für Eure Aufmerksamkeit.
  
-Feedback willkommmen an [[work@mro.name?subject=Cocoaheads Vortrag: Parser mit Ragel|Marcus Rohrmoser]]+Feedback willkommmen an [[work@mro.name?subject=Cocoaheads Vortrag: Schnelle Suche|Marcus Rohrmoser]]
  
 Die Folien zum Nachlesen gibt's hier: Die Folien zum Nachlesen gibt's hier:
cocoaheads/binary_search.1296063523.txt.gz · Zuletzt geändert: 2011/01/26 18:38 von mro